[New York, October 2024] Silicon Drift Detector Equipment represents a pivotal technology within the realm of radiation detection and imaging. Leveraging advanced semiconductor technology, these detectors offer rapid, high-resolution response capabilities, significantly enhancing analytical precision. Industries such as medical imaging, nuclear research, and material analysis heavily rely on the superior performance of Silicon Drift Detectors (SDDs) to detect and differentiate various types of radiation, making them invaluable tools in ensuring safety and efficacy.
